South Eliot

City in Maine, United States

Overview

South Eliot is a quiet riverside community in southern Maine, close to the lively city of Portsmouth, New Hampshire. Known for its small-town charm, natural beauty, and easy access to coastal attractions, it's ideal for those seeking peace with the perks of nearby urban life.
